Upgrade to Pro — share decks privately, control downloads, hide ads and more …

スピンアウト講座01_GitHub管理

 スピンアウト講座01_GitHub管理

ファイルの変更履歴を記録・共有するGitHubの基本を、GoogleDriveとの違いから理解します。覚える用語は7つ。Obsidian Vaultとの自動同期も設定します。

OffersにはAI Talent(トップクラスAI人材)が多数登録しています。その方たちとチームを組み、AIコンサルティングサービスを開始しています。ご関心のある方はこちらからご登録ください。順次、弊社よりご連絡させていただきます。
https://share-na2.hsforms.com/13F_F95BrTLaqRMk1hYhxQg3rs27

Avatar for overflow ,Inc

overflow ,Inc

March 21, 2026
Tweet

More Decks by overflow ,Inc

Other Decks in Technology

Transcript

  1. GitHubとは何か CONFIDENTIAL © Offers All rights reserved. 1 Claude Code活用で直面する4つの課題

    チーム共有 CLAUDE.mdや SKILL.mdを チームで共有したい 変更履歴 Obsidian Vaultの 変更履歴を安全に管理 したい バックアップ 設定ファイルのバック アップを クラウド上に持ちたい 同時編集 複数人で同じナレッジ ベースを 同時に編集したい これらすべてを解決するのが GitHub です
  2. GitHubとは何か CONFIDENTIAL © Offers All rights reserved. 2 クラウドストレージとの決定的な違い 機能

    Google Drive Dropbox GitHub ファイル保存 ✓ ✓ ✓ 変更履歴 一部(Docs等) 30日間 全期間・全ファイル 差分確認 ✕ ✕ 行単位で差分表示 変更理由の記録 ✕ ✕ コミットメッセージ 巻き戻し 限定的 限定的 任意の時点に完全復元 ブランチ(実験) ✕ ✕ 別バージョンで実験可能 無料容量 15GB 2GB 無制限(リポジトリ単位)
  3. GitHubとは何か CONFIDENTIAL © Offers All rights reserved. 3 GitHubの3つの核心的メリット 全履歴

    いつ・誰が・なぜ 変更したか全部残る 6ヶ月前に消した段落の復元も 変更者の追跡も可能 安心 壊しても 1コマンドで戻せる 新しい設定を試して失敗しても すぐに元の状態に復元 唯一 「1つの正解」を 全員が見られる 最新のCLAUDE.mdはどこ? → GitHubに1つだけある
  4. 基本操作を覚える CONFIDENTIAL © Offers All rights reserved. 4 覚えるのは7つだけ 用語

    意味 身近な例え リポジトリ ファイルの保管庫 1冊のノート クローン リポジトリをPCにコピー ノートのコピーを手元に作る コミット 変更を記録する(セーブポイント) 「ここまでOK」と印をつける プッシュ PCの変更をGitHubに送る 共有フォルダに反映 プル GitHubの最新をPCに取込 最新をダウンロード ブランチ 本体に影響を与えず実験 下書き用の別ページ マージ ブランチの変更を本体に統合 下書きを清書に反映
  5. 基本操作を覚える CONFIDENTIAL © Offers All rights reserved. 5 ローカル ⇔

    クラウドの関係 あなたのPC(ローカル) ファイルを編集 ↓ コミット(記録) GitHub(クラウド) チーム全員が見る 「唯一の正解」 他の人の変更も反映 push → ← pull
  6. 基本操作を覚える CONFIDENTIAL © Offers All rights reserved. 6 日常の4ステップ操作フロー 1

    ▶ 確認 git status 今の状態を確認する 2 ▶ 追加 git add . 変更ファイルを 記録対象に 3 ▶ 記録 git commit 変更を記録する 4 送信 git push GitHubに送る
  7. 基本操作を覚える CONFIDENTIAL © Offers All rights reserved. 7 変更履歴の確認と巻き戻し 01

    履歴を見る git log --oneline 過去のコミット一覧を確認。特定 ファイルだけの履歴も閲覧可能 02 差分を確認 git diff HEAD~1 直前の変更内容を行単位で確認。 何が変わったか一目でわかる 03 元に戻す git checkout HEAD~1 -- 特定のファイルだけ過去の状態に 復元。安全な巻き戻し
  8. 発展的な機能を活用する CONFIDENTIAL © Offers All rights reserved. 8 Issues &

    Pull Requestでチーム運用 Issues(課題管理) タスクや課題を管理する掲示板 SKILL.mdの改善要望を記録 新しい自動化の検討をIssueで議論 バグ報告をIssueで追跡 gh issue create --title "タイトル" Pull Request(変更レビュー) 「この変更を入れていいですか?」という提案 1 ブランチを作る 2 編集してコミット 3 PRを作成 4 レビュー → マージ
  9. 発展的な機能を活用する CONFIDENTIAL © Offers All rights reserved. 9 GitHub Actionsで自動化する

    ファイルの変更をトリガーに 自動で処理を実行できる CLAUDE.md更新 → Slack通知 SKILL.md追加 → ドキュメント自動生成 定期的にClaude Codeタスクを実行 CLAUDE.md を更新(Push) ▼ GitHub Actions が検知・実行 ▼ Slack に自動通知
  10. 発展的な機能を活用する CONFIDENTIAL © Offers All rights reserved. 10 Copilot SpacesでAIとナレッジ連携

    コード・ドキュメント・ナレッジを1箇所にまとめて AIが参照できるようにする機能 ナレッジ集約 チームのナレッジベースを Spaceにまとめる AI参照 CopilotがSpace内の 情報を使って回答 組織共有 組織内で 共有可能
  11. Obsidian × GitHub実践 CONFIDENTIAL © Offers All rights reserved. 11

    連携が解決する4つの課題 課題 BEFORE AFTER(GitHub連携) バックアップ バックアップがない GitHubが自動バックアップに 複数PC同期 手動でコピーが必要 Push/Pullで同期 チーム共有 共有方法がない プライベートリポジトリで共有 変更追跡 誰がいつ何を変えたか不明 コミット履歴で追跡 → Obsidian Git プラグインで完全自動化が可能
  12. Obsidian × GitHub実践 CONFIDENTIAL © Offers All rights reserved. 12

    Obsidian Gitプラグインの設定 1 ▶ インストール 設定 → コミュニティプラグイン →「Obsidian Git」で検索 2 ▶ 有効化 インストール後 有効化をONにする 3 設定 下記の推奨値で 自動同期を設定 設定項目 推奨値 説明 Auto backup interval 30(分) 30分ごとに自動コミット&プッシュ Auto pull interval 30(分) 30分ごとに自動プル Commit message vault backup: {{date}} コミットメッセージの形式 Pull on startup ON 起動時に最新を取得
  13. Obsidian × GitHub実践 CONFIDENTIAL © Offers All rights reserved. 13

    チーム活用3パターン 01 ナレッジ共有 CLAUDE.md・SKILL.md・テン プレートを1つのリポジトリで全 員共有。「最新はどこ?」がなく なる 02 CLAUDE.md統制 mainブランチを保護し、変更は PR経由のみ。勝手にルールが変 わらず、変更理由も記録に残る 03 セキュリティ管理 .gitignoreでAPIキー・認証情報・ 個人メモをGitHubにアップしな いよう制御。情報漏洩を防止
  14. Obsidian × GitHub実践 CONFIDENTIAL © Offers All rights reserved. 14

    実践課題チェックリスト ✓ 実践課題 レベル □ GitHubアカウントを作成し、GitHub CLI (gh) をインストールする 必須 □ テスト用のプライベートリポジトリを作成する 必須 □ Obsidian VaultをGitHubリポジトリとして初期化する 必須 □ コミット → プッシュ → GitHubで確認、の一連の流れを体験する 必須 □ Obsidian Gitプラグインを導入し、自動同期を設定する 推奨 □ .gitignoreで除外すべきファイルを設定する 推奨 □ メンバーをリポジトリに招待し、共同編集を体験する チーム APIキーやパスワードが含まれるファイルは絶対にGitHubに上げない
  15.     ── AI時代のエンジニア転職プラットフォーム AIにできないことが1つだけあります。それは「何がしたいか」という夢を持つこと。 人間ならではの好奇心や違和感こそが、未来で最も価値ある「問い」になる。 Offersは、個人の「問い」と企業の「問い」が響き合い、新しい価値を生み出す場所です。 求職者の方へ Offersは「今すぐ転職する人」だけのサービスではありません。AI 時代のキャリア相談、先端AI企業への転職、職務経歴の棚卸しやAI による強み分析も可能です。 offers.jp

    ─ まずは無料登録 Offers職務経歴 AIx人間ハイブリッドの職務経歴作成サービス 企業の方へ OffersはAI RPOサービスです。35,000人以上の登録ユーザーからAI が最適な候補者を発見し、心理フェーズに合わせたスカウトを自動 配信。採用戦略の設計は専任CSチームが伴走し、「再現性ある採 用」を実現します。 サービスを見てみる PR
  16. FIN